Introduction

This course provides an understanding of contemporary international relations and advanced skills in research and analytical thinking.

Course Entry Requirements/Prerequisites

A bachelor degree in any field of study from a recognised tertiary education institution.

Recognition of Prior Learning

Applications for recognition of prior learning are assessed on an individual basis.

Duration and Availability

This fee-paying course is one semester full-time or equivalent part-time study.

Additional Course Expenses

Students may be expected to purchase a number of textbooks, readers and other essential study materials.
